What Is Payroll Outsourcing?
Payroll outsourcing involves handing over the responsibility of calculating employee pay, tax deductions, pensions, and reporting duties to a specialist third-party provider—like Legacy Outsourcing.
Our team handles:
- Weekly/monthly payroll processing
- RTI submissions to HMRC
- Payslip generation
- Auto-enrolment pension contributions
- Year-end P60s, P45s, and P11Ds
- Compliance with the latest UK payroll legislation
Why Businesses Are Outsourcing Payroll in 2025
1. Saves Time & Reduces Admin Headaches
Payroll is detail-heavy and time-sensitive. Outsourcing it gives you back hours every month—time you can spend growing your business, not chasing payslips.
2. Avoid Costly Errors
UK payroll laws are strict, and even small mistakes can result in fines or late payment penalties. An outsourced provider ensures your business stays compliant with:
- National Minimum Wage
- PAYE tax codes
- Statutory sick and maternity pay
- RTI submissions
3. Stays Compliant with Changing Legislation
HMRC updates can be frequent and complex. A professional payroll partner keeps up with legislation, so you don’t have to.
4. Improves Data Security
In-house payroll can be a security risk if sensitive data isn’t properly protected. Reputable outsourcing providers use encrypted, GDPR-compliant platforms to keep everything secure and auditable.
5. Cost-Effective Compared to Hiring In-House
Hiring a payroll clerk or finance team can be costly—especially for small to mid-sized companies. Outsourcing gives you access to experienced professionals without the full-time salary burden.
